From 179d69e6d1e8f18270e7cf25c0c16bf1a0ac0352 Mon Sep 17 00:00:00 2001 From: 101captain <237651143@qq.com> Date: 星期六, 23 七月 2022 14:59:31 +0800 Subject: [PATCH] bug修改 --- spring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/service/impl/ComPbMemberWestServiceImpl.java | 24 +++++++++++++----------- 1 files changed, 13 insertions(+), 11 deletions(-) diff --git a/spring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/service/impl/ComPbMemberWestServiceImpl.java b/spring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/service/impl/ComPbMemberWestServiceImpl.java index 5e0e2ff..0e52346 100644 --- a/spring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/service/impl/ComPbMemberWestServiceImpl.java +++ b/spring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/service/impl/ComPbMemberWestServiceImpl.java @@ -754,17 +754,19 @@ log.error("年龄转义失败"); } //查询党员统计数据 - ComDataStatisticsMemberVo statisticsMemberVo = comPbMemberWestDAO.getMemberStatistics(member.getUserId(),member.getCommunityId()); - if(statisticsMemberVo != null){ - member.setPartyActivityCount(statisticsMemberVo.getPartyActivityCount()); - member.setPartyActivityDuration(statisticsMemberVo.getPartyActivityDuration()); - member.setVolunteerActivityCount(statisticsMemberVo.getVolunteerActivityCount()); - member.setVolunteerActivityDuration(statisticsMemberVo.getVolunteerActivityDuration()); - member.setVolunteerActivityIntegral(statisticsMemberVo.getVolunteerActivityIntegral()); - member.setWishCount(statisticsMemberVo.getWishCount()); - member.setEasyCount(statisticsMemberVo.getEasyCount()); - member.setActivityCount(member.getPartyActivityCount() + member.getVolunteerActivityCount()); - member.setActivityDuration(member.getPartyActivityDuration() + member.getVolunteerActivityDuration()); + if(member.getUserId()!=null&&member.getCommunityId()!=null){ + ComDataStatisticsMemberVo statisticsMemberVo = comPbMemberWestDAO.getMemberStatistics(member.getUserId(),member.getCommunityId()); + if(statisticsMemberVo != null){ + member.setPartyActivityCount(statisticsMemberVo.getPartyActivityCount()); + member.setPartyActivityDuration(statisticsMemberVo.getPartyActivityDuration()); + member.setVolunteerActivityCount(statisticsMemberVo.getVolunteerActivityCount()); + member.setVolunteerActivityDuration(statisticsMemberVo.getVolunteerActivityDuration()); + member.setVolunteerActivityIntegral(statisticsMemberVo.getVolunteerActivityIntegral()); + member.setWishCount(statisticsMemberVo.getWishCount()); + member.setEasyCount(statisticsMemberVo.getEasyCount()); + member.setActivityCount(member.getPartyActivityCount() + member.getVolunteerActivityCount()); + member.setActivityDuration(member.getPartyActivityDuration() + member.getVolunteerActivityDuration()); + } } }); return R.ok(memberPage); -- Gitblit v1.7.1